Ex-Christie Aide Gets 13 Months In Bridgegate Scandal

New York’s WINS radio reports: Bridget Anne Kelly, former Gov. Chris Christie’s deputy chief of staff who became a central figure in the infamous “Bridgegate” scandal, was sentenced on Wednesday by a federal judge to 13 months in prison for her role in shutting down lanes to the George Washington Bridge. Christie Withdraws From Chief Of Staff Consideration

The Hill reports: Former New Jersey Gov. Chris Christie (R) declined the White House chief of staff role on Friday. Christie and President Trump reportedly met last night to discuss the role of replacing John Kelly, who will be departing as chief of staff by the end of the year.
